Home | History | Annotate | Download | only in Sema

Lines Matching full:warning

13   gc = 0x5, // no-warning
14 gd = 0x7, // expected-warning {{enumeration value 'gd' is out of range}}
15 ge = ~0x2, // expected-warning {{enumeration value 'ge' is out of range}}
16 gf = ~0x4, // no-warning
17 gg = ~0x1, // no-warning
18 gh = ~0x5, // no-warning
19 gi = ~0x11, // expected-warning {{enumeration value 'gi' is out of range}}
24 fb = ~0x1u, // no-warning
36 hc = ~0x1u, // expected-warning {{enumeration value 'hc' is out of range}}
37 hd = ~0x2, // no-warning
41 enum flag e = 0; // no-warning
42 e = 0x1; // no-warning
43 e = 0x3; // no-warning
44 e = 0xa; // no-warning
45 e = 0x4; // expected-warning {{integer constant not in range of enumerated type}}
46 e = 0xf; // expected-warning {{integer constant not in range of enumerated type}}
47 e = ~0; // no-warning
48 e = ~0x1; // no-warning
49 e = ~0x2; // no-warning
50 e = ~0x3; // no-warning
51 e = ~0x4; // expected-warning {{integer constant not in range of enumerated type}}
54 case 0: break; // no-warning
55 case 0x1: break; // no-warning
56 case 0x3: break; // no-warning
57 case 0xa: break; // no-warning
58 case 0x4: break; // expected-warning {{case value not in enumerated type}}
59 case 0xf: break; // expected-warning {{case value not in enumerated type}}
60 case ~0: break; // expected-warning {{case value not in enumerated type}}
61 case ~0x1: break; // expected-warning {{case value not in enumerated type}}
62 case ~0x2: break; // expected-warning {{case value not in enumerated type}}
63 case ~0x3: break; // expected-warning {{case value not in enumerated type}}
64 case ~0x4: break; // expected-warning {{case value not in enumerated type}}
68 enum flag2 f = ~0x1; // no-warning
69 f = ~0x1u; // no-warning
71 enum flag4 h = ~0x1; // no-warning
72 h = ~0x1u; // expected-warning {{integer constant not in range of enumerated type}}